简历

包云岗博士于2003年本科毕业于南京大学,2008年获中科院计算所博士学位,现为中科院计算所研究员,博士生导师,先进计算机系统研究中心副主任。研究方向主要是计算机体系结构, 目前正在开展高效能数据中心设计与优化技术方面的研究。博士期间带领小组设计与实现了软硬件结合的计算机访存监控HMTT系统,为十几个国内外大学研究机构与企业提供访存Trace数据。2010年到2012年在普林斯顿大学李凯教授小组开展博士后研究,负责开发维护PARSEC多核基准测试集,并发布PARSEC 3.0版本。包云岗博士在国际顶级计算机系统会议期刊(如ASPLOS/ISCA/HPCA/Sigmetrics等)发表了一系列论文,曾两次获计算所优秀论文一等奖,获2013年”CCF-Intel青年学者提升计划”奖。

主要经历:

  2015.05 ~         先进计算机系统研究中心副主任,中科院计算所

  2015.09 ~         研究员,中科院计算所

  2011.09 ~ 2015.08 副研究员,中科院计算所

  2010.10 ~ 2012.09 博士后,普林斯顿大学计算机系

  2008.09 ~ 2011.09 助理研究员,中科院计算所

教育背景:

  2003.9 ~ 2008.09 工学博士,中科院计算所

  1999.09 ~ 2003.07 理学学士,南京大学计算机科学与技术系
